ING International Graduate Programme  

This four-year programme builds on your skills, providing value to your professional development at each stage.

Year 1: INSPIRE

You are ‘inspired’ to learn more about ING as a global organisation, how you can personally contribute to its’ growth and to develop yourself as a high performer through global marketplace and workplace knowledge.

Year 2: CONNECT

You and the other participants come together again for more in-depth personal development relevant to your career paths within ING, as well as allowing you the opportunity to ‘re-connect’ as a group to strengthen the global networks formed in INSPIRE.

Year 3: PERFORM

You apply and leverage the knowledge gained through the IIGP and your own ‘on-the-job’ experience to provide tangible results to the business through real-life business case or project work.

Year 4: LEAD

Participants will be selected to attend LEAD based upon their proven high performance and leadership potential based on past 3-year’s performance reviews and an assessment. LEAD focuses on the key elements of the ‘ING Leadership Profile’ and provides participants with their final step on the path to becoming a true leader and ambassador for ING’s high performance culture.
